The global PET bottles market was valued at USD 26.6 Bn in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 35.7 Bn by the end of 2032. Supported by rising demand from the beverage, food, and personal care industries, along with the growing focus on lightweight and recyclable packaging solutions, the market is expected to expand at a CAGR of 3.3% from 2024 to 2032.

PET bottles are employed in various end-use industries such as food & beverage, healthcare, personal care, and domestic cleaning owing to their superior stiffness which enhances longer shelf life, maintains a robust protective structure, and improves protection during the storage and transportation stages.

Market Segmentation

By Sourcing Type (Resin Type)

  • Virgin PET: Currently holds the largest share due to lower production costs and high clarity requirements.
  • Recycled PET (rPET): The fastest-growing segment, fueled by brand commitments (e.g., Coca-Cola, PepsiCo) and government mandates.
  • Bio-based/Sugarcane PET: An emerging segment gaining traction in the premium and eco-conscious beverage sectors.

By Application (Product Type)

  • Packaged Water: The dominant application segment.
  • Carbonated Soft Drinks (CSD): High volume share due to PET’s ability to retain carbonation.
  • Fruit Juices & Energy Drinks: Growth driven by the health-conscious consumer base.
  • Alcoholic Beverages: Increasing adoption in the beer and wine sectors (e.g., ALPLA’s recyclable PET wine bottles).

By Industry Vertical

  • Food & Beverages: The largest vertical, accounting for over 38% of the market.
  • Pharmaceuticals: The fastest-growing vertical (6.95% CAGR), utilizing PET for its sterile barrier properties.
  • Personal Care & Cosmetics: Used for shampoos, mouthwashes, and lotions.
  • Household Care: Packaging for detergents and cleaning agents.

By Technology

  • Stretch Blow Molding (SBM): The leading technology due to its efficiency and bottle quality.
  • Injection Molding: Primarily used for preforms.
  • Extrusion Blow Molding (EBM): Gaining ground for complex designs and handles.

Regional Analysis

Region

Market Dynamics

Asia Pacific

Dominant Region. Holds a share of over 38%. Growth is led by China and India due to urbanization and massive consumption of bottled water.

North America

Mature market focusing on lightweighting and rPET infrastructure. The U.S. market is projected to reach ~USD 12.18 billion by 2032.

Europe

Leader in sustainability and regulation. Significant investments in chemical recycling and bioplastics are centered here.

Middle East & Africa

Fastest-growing region (8.05% CAGR). Growth is driven by expanding retail channels and the need for safe drinking water.

Latin America

Steady growth driven by increased consumer spending and the e-commerce boom in Brazil and Mexico.

 

Market Drivers and Challenges

Drivers

  • Sustainability Pledges: Major FMCG brands are committing to 100% recyclable or 50% rPET content by 2030.
  • Urbanization & E-commerce: The rise of home delivery requires durable, lightweight packaging that minimizes shipping costs.
  • Technological Innovation: Advancements in "barrier-coated" PET extend the shelf life of sensitive products like milk and beer.

Challenges

  • Raw Material Volatility: Fluctuations in crude oil prices directly impact the cost of virgin PET resin.
  • Collection Infrastructure: In many developing regions, the lack of efficient waste management systems limits the supply of high-quality rPET.
  • Substitute Materials: Rising competition from aluminum cans and glass for "premium" positioning.

Market Trends & Future Outlook

  • Lightweighting: Manufacturers are reducing bottle weights (e.g., from 21g to 18.5g) to lower carbon footprints and logistics costs.
  • Smart Packaging: Integration of QR codes and sensors for track-and-trace capabilities in the pharmaceutical and luxury beverage sectors.
  • Chemical Recycling: Moving beyond mechanical recycling to break down plastic to its molecular level, allowing for "infinite" recycling without quality loss.

Recent Developments

  • In 2023, Retal Czech started the production of a popular monolayer preform at its Melnik facility. The 26/22 GME 30.37 preform is available in a range of weights and is ideally suited to the European markets for carbonated and non-carbonated beverages that already use this neck finish.
  • In 2023, Resilux partnered with Inex, a frontrunner in authentic dairy products, to launch the Rebirth series, a sustainable and circular solution of white opaque milk bottles
